Understanding User Experience (UX): A Guide to Enhancing Customer Experience

Written by
Cedric Atkinson

In today's digital age, user experience (UX) plays a critical role in the success of any business. Understanding and improving UX has become an essential element in establishing customer loyalty, engagement, and long-term satisfaction. In this guide, we explore the importance of UX and how it impacts customer experience, as well as key elements of good UX design, and a handy guide to the UX design process.

The Importance of User Experience (UX)

When it comes to designing a website or digital product, focusing on the user experience is vital. As users, we expect an interface that is intuitive, easy to navigate, and aesthetically pleasing. Additionally, we want websites and products that are accessible, useful, and meet our goals and objectives as quickly and efficiently as possible.

Defining User Experience

UX refers to the user's perception of interacting with a website or digital product, including their emotions, attitudes, and behaviours. It encompasses a range of factors, including aesthetics, usability, accessibility, and functionality. These elements work together to shape the user's overall experience and satisfaction with the interface.

When designing for UX, it is important to keep in mind that users have different needs and abilities. For example, users with disabilities may require assistive technology to access information on a website. Good UX design takes these differences into account and ensures that the interface is accessible to all users.

The Connection Between UX and Customer Satisfaction

Implementing good UX design enhances customer satisfaction by creating an interface that meets their needs and aligns with their expectations. A strong UX design takes into account the user's goals, preferences, behaviours, and past experiences and adapts to them to provide a seamless experience.

For example, a website that sells shoes may have a feature that recommends similar products based on the user's past purchases. This feature caters to the user's preferences and makes the shopping experience more personalized and enjoyable.

With good UX, the user feels valued and understood, leading to increased engagement, loyalty, and repeat business. Users are more likely to recommend a website or product to others if they have had a positive experience.

The Business Benefits of Good UX

Good UX design not only benefits customers but also has a direct impact on the business's bottom line. Companies that prioritize UX design see improved user engagement, which leads to increased conversions and sales.

For example, a website that has a clear and easy-to-use checkout process is more likely to convert visitors into customers. A confusing or lengthy checkout process may result in abandoned carts and lost sales.

Additionally, good UX reduces the need for customer support and streamlines the buying process, resulting in a more cost-effective and efficient business operation. A website that is easy to use and navigate reduces the number of customer inquiries and complaints, freeing up resources to focus on other areas of the business.

In conclusion, prioritizing UX design is essential for creating a successful website or digital product. By focusing on the user's needs and preferences, businesses can enhance customer satisfaction, increase engagement and loyalty, and improve their bottom line.

Key Elements of User Experience Design

When designing for UX, there are several critical elements that must be considered. Understanding each of these elements and integrating them into the design process will help elevate the user experience and enhance customer engagement.

Usability

Usability refers to the ease with which a user can interact with a website or product. It involves the user's understanding of how the interface works and how they can accomplish their goals efficiently. Good usability design minimizes friction and confusion, making the interface intuitive and easy to navigate.

For example, a website that sells clothing should have clear categories and filters for users to find what they are looking for quickly and easily. The search bar should be prominently displayed and work efficiently. The checkout process should be straightforward, with clear instructions and minimal steps.

Accessibility

Accessibility means designing an interface that can be used by as many users as possible, regardless of their age, experience, or ability. This includes considerations for visual impairments, hearing disabilities, and mobility issues. By implementing accessible design principles and adhering to the guidelines, more users can enjoy and benefit from the interface.

For instance, an e-learning platform should have closed captions for videos and transcripts for audio content to cater to users with hearing disabilities. The platform should also be navigable using only a keyboard to cater to users with mobility issues.

Consistency

Consistency refers to providing a stable, predictable, and familiar interface. Users expect consistency in the design elements, layout, and navigation, and deviations from this can lead to confusion and frustration. A consistent interface establishes a pattern of familiarity that helps users accomplish their tasks efficiently and effectively.

For example, a social media platform should have a consistent layout, with the logo and navigation bar in the same place throughout the platform. The colour scheme and typography should also be consistent, creating a cohesive and recognizable brand identity.

Flexibility

Flexibility is the ability of an interface to adapt and change based on the user's needs and preferences. A flexible interface allows users to customize their experience, making it more personalized and effective. This can include elements such as font size, colour preference, and layout choices.

For instance, a news website should allow users to customize their news feed based on their interests. Users should be able to adjust the font size and colour scheme to suit their preferences.

Aesthetics

Aesthetics refer to the attractiveness and overall visual appeal of the interface. A good-looking design can help establish trust, build credibility, and create a positive emotional connection with the user. Furthermore, aesthetics work in harmony with usability, accessibility, consistency, and flexibility to deliver an enhanced user experience.

For example, a food delivery app should have high-quality images of the food, a visually appealing colour scheme, and an intuitive layout that makes it easy for users to order food.

The UX Design Process

A successful UX design process involves several stages, including research and discovery, design and prototyping, testing and validation, implementation and launch, and ongoing evaluation and iteration.

Research and Discovery

In the research and discovery stage, the focus is on understanding the user, their needs, and the challenges they face. This includes conducting market research, surveys, and user testing to gather insights and data that will inform the design process.

Market research involves analyzing data about the target audience, such as their demographics, behaviour patterns, and preferences. This information helps designers create a product that meets the needs of the target audience.

Surveys are a powerful tool for gathering feedback from potential users. Surveys can be conducted online or in person and can provide valuable insights into user preferences, pain points, and expectations.

User testing involves observing users as they interact with a prototype or early version of the product. This provides designers with feedback on how users are likely to interact with the product and helps identify areas for improvement.

Design and Prototyping

During the design and prototyping stage, the focus shifts to creating visual mockups and prototypes that reflect the insights and data gathered during the prior stage. This phase includes wireframes, prototypes, and user flow diagrams to demonstrate how the final product will work.

Wireframes are simple sketches of the product's layout and functionality. They help designers visualize the product's structure and layout, without getting bogged down in details like color and typography.

Prototypes are interactive models of the product. They allow designers to test the product's functionality and user experience in a simulated environment. This helps identify any issues that need to be addressed before the product is launched.

User flow diagrams show how users will move through the product, from start to finish. This helps designers identify any potential roadblocks or areas where users may get confused or frustrated.

Testing and Validation

The testing and validation phase involves testing the prototype with real users to identify any usability, accessibility, and functional issues that need to be addressed. This process allows the designers to refine the design before it is implemented.

Usability testing involves observing users as they interact with the product. This provides feedback on how easy the product is to use, and helps identify any areas where users may get stuck or confused.

Accessibility testing ensures that the product is accessible to users with disabilities. This includes testing for screen readers, color contrast, and keyboard navigation.

Functional testing ensures that the product works as intended. This includes testing for bugs, glitches, and errors.

Implementation and Launch

The implementation and launch phase involve transforming the design into a functional product. This involves coding and integrating the design elements, testing the final product, and preparing for launch.

Coding involves turning the design into functional code that can be used to build the product. This requires knowledge of programming languages like HTML, CSS, and JavaScript.

Integration involves combining the different parts of the product into a cohesive whole. This includes integrating the design elements with the code, and ensuring that all the different parts of the product work together seamlessly.

Testing the final product ensures that it is ready for launch. This includes testing for bugs, glitches, and errors, as well as ensuring that the product meets all the necessary standards and regulations.

Ongoing Evaluation and Iteration

Once launched, the focus shifts to ongoing evaluation and iteration. User feedback and data collected through analytics are used to make improvements to the user experience continually. This phase ensures that the product remains relevant and effective over time.

User feedback can be gathered through surveys, focus groups, and other forms of feedback. This feedback can be used to identify areas for improvement and to make changes to the product that better meet the needs of users.

Analytics tools can provide valuable insights into how users are interacting with the product. This includes information like how long users spend on each page, where they click, and how they navigate the product. This information can be used to identify areas for improvement and to make changes that improve the user experience.

Overall, the UX design process is a complex and iterative process that requires a deep understanding of the user and their needs. By following a structured process that includes research, design, testing, implementation, and ongoing evaluation, designers can create products that are both effective and user-friendly.

Conclusion

Good UX design is critical to the success of any business. By understanding the importance of user experience, implementing the key elements of UX design and following the UX design process, organizations can create interfaces that enhance the user experience, improve customer satisfaction, and drive business success.